Artist Alliance 1st entertainment marketing firm to focus on south cinema

One of the leading production houses down south ' Geetha Arts, now partners with KWAN, India's premier entertainment and marketing company to form Artist Alliance 'India's first ever entertainment marketing firm focused on South Indian cinema. Floated by two of the biggest names in the entertainment business, Artist Alliance will replicate KWAN's business model in Southern Cinema working in the areas of celebrity management, movie marketing, in-film placements, casting, television and event sponsorships.

The clients managed by Artists Alliance (KWAN + Geetha Arts jointly) already include Suriya, Ram Charan Teja, Allu Arjun, Simbu, Tamannaah Bhatia, Shruti Haasan and Kajal Aggarwal. The management of the South careers of a few more Bollywood celebrities is also in the pipeline and the associations will be announced soon.
